Six Kentucky Corporations Achieve 2010 Fortune 500 Ranking

By wmadministrator


Six Kentucky–based corporations have been named to Fortune magazine’s annual Fortune 500 list, which ranks the nation’s largest public companies according to their 2009 revenues.

Making their appearance on the 2010 list were Humana, Yum Brands, Ashland, Omnicare, General Cable and Kindred Healthcare.

Humana, a Louisville-based health insurance company, led the Kentucky companies, coming in at No. 73 (up from No. 85 in 2009) based on revenue of $30 billion.

Yum Brands, the Louisville-based parent company of KFC, Pizza Hut, Long John Silver’s, Taco Bell and A&W, moved up to No. 219 from last year’s No. 239 and reported 2009 revenue of $10.9 billion.

Ashland, a major chemicals company headquartered in Covington, came in at No. 280 (up from 310 in 2009), with revenue of $8.1 billion.

Omnicare, a pharmaceutical company also headquartered in Covington, came in at No. 347 with revenue of $6.2 billion, moving up from No. 392 in 2009.

General Cable, a Highland Heights company that made its first appearance on the list last year with a ranking of 396, dropped to No. 469, with revenue of $4.3 billion.

Louisville-based Kindred Healthcare returned to the Fortune 500 for the first time since 2007, coming in at No. 477 with revenue of $4.3 billion.
